Ultra-Quick Guide to Cover Letters

|

For an ultra-quick guide to cover-letter format, you can’t beat this instruction from career counselor Louise Giordano: Be brief, appropriate, and professional. In her article for Quint Careers, Cover Letters Count!, Giordano also offers this formatting advice:

  • Length: No more than one page; generally no more than four paragraphs.
  • Tone: Professional, not too stuffy or too casual. Read the letter aloud or to someone else to check for tone.
  • Appropriateness: Avoid extraneous cliches, fillers, and superfluous information — but be honest and sincere.
